Changelog --------- 2.0.1: Medea's ruse - Bug fix: -- [Mac]; [rest], [oauth]: Loading libcurl dependencies from correct locations on build. 2.0.0: Medea - BREAKING; [oauth], [rest], [json-decode]: Change outlet order to Pd standard order -- right outlet outputs on error -- middle outlet outputs data -- left outlet outputs bang on done - deken packages include dependencies for all systems, including Linux - Updated help files and examples - [Mac]; [rest], [oauth]: OS X now uses system certificate authority information - [Mac] Support for newer OS X versions - [Linux] arm64 packages - Support for multiinstance Pd on compile time added - Bug fixes: -- [json-encode]: Can read files again -- [rest], [oauth]: Fixed crash on closing patch while waiting for data -- [Windows]; [rest], [oauth]: Cancelling requests on Windows working, although not as fast as on true POSIX compliant systems - Internal: Switch to Circle CI for compilation 1.4.3: Y U no stable API - Bug fix: compilation works with json-c >= 0.13 - Bug fix: remove boilerplate display in Pd console 1.4.2: Argo in Shipyard - Update of build scripts and documentation - Usage of CI for build 1.4.1: Orpheus's Lyre - Bug fix: -- [json-encode] and [json-decode]: Correctly freeing JSON object memory - Removed Google API calls from help - Switch Makefile to pd-lib-builder - Remove building of own Debian packages - [Mac] Add liboauth build as homebrew script 1.4.0: My neighbor TOR - [rest] and [oauth]: proxy enabled - updated manual 1.3.0: Trickle down theory - [json-encode] and [urlparams]: optimisation of logic - [rest] and [oauth]: HTTP streaming enabled - Rewrite of manual - Bug fix: -- [oauth]: unitialised object does not request data - Refactoring of source code: -- moved source to subfolders -- static analysis of source code 1.2.0: OAuth rly - [oauth]: PATCH, TRACE and OPTIONS request implemented 1.1.0: Wow! Much request! Such test! - [rest]: HEAD, PATCH, TRACE and OPTIONS request implemented - [oauth]: HEAD request implemented - Bug fixes: -- [rest] and [oauth]: Mac OS X needs cacert.pem -- [json-encode]: differentiate between float and integer values - unit tests for [json-decode], [json-encode], [urlparams] 1.0.0: Pendulum - Info for users while loading object - Bug fixes in [json-encode]: -- array handling -- number handling - Refactoring 0.15.0: The API they are a-changing - Cancellation is now faster - Switch to json-c 0.11 - Refactoring of code - Breaking changes: -- [oauth] and [rest]: * [write( method is now called [file( * [url( method is now called [init( * init errors only output to console * changes to status outlet: ** on success output bang ** on HTTP error output numerical HTTP status ** on cURL error output list: error code and message -- [rest-json] has been removed -- [json-decode]: * string values will not be checked for numbers or boolean 0.14.0: Davo - Downloading to file - Cancelling requests - Switch to libcurl multi interface 0.13.0: heady stuff - Setting HTTP headers possible - Cancelling of requests possible while waiting (experimental) - Switched Makefile to libary template 1.0.14 - Semantic versioning 0.12.1: I accidentally the whole cookie - Bugfix: Cookie authentication is working again. 0.12: The multitude came together - Disabling checking peer for SSL requests in [rest] and [oauth] possible - [urlparams] does now overwrite previously set parameters - RSA-SHA1 signature possible, otherwise info message is posted to Pd console - Bugfixes: -- SSL requests on Windows possible -- regression fixed for PUT requests 0.11: long string is long - symbols can be longer than MAXPDLENGTH (1024 characters) - [json-decode] works with lists and any other data type as well - Setting request timeout for [rest] and [oauth] possible - Bugfixes: -- [oauth] posts data again -- Fixed segfault in Windows at errors - Cleaning up of source code and help files 0.10: - no version 0.10 due to problems in Pd (cuts off trailing 0) 0.9: sailing to Colchis - [json-encode] writes and reads JSON data to and from files - [oauth] does not use deprecated functions from liboauth 1.0 - [oauth] and [rest] share functions - [json-encode] and [urlparams] share functions - Bugfixes: -- POST sends correct parameter data -- HTTP errors are displayed with error code 0.8: I did, I did taw a putty tat - Added objects: [oauth] [urlparams] [rest] - [rest-json] is now an abstraction - Bugfixes - Better examples and help patches 0.7.1: Cookie monster on the couch - Unlocking [rest-json] when HTTP status is not 200. - Fix for segfault at json_object_put(). 0.7: Cookie monster on the couch - Cookie authentication, useful for CouchDB login - [rest-json] has a third outlet - Refactoring 0.6: - Lots of bugfixes 0.5: - Locking [rest-json] more restrictively - Makefile is now ready for packaging - Debian package is available 0.4.1: - Hopefully fixed threading issues 0.4: - Fixed cross-thread access to rest object - Fixed stack overflow issue of threads - Refactoring 0.3: - Fixed memory leaks - Added manual 0.2.1: - Added this Changelog 0.2: - Renamed library to purest_json - Outputting nested JSON objects and arrays as strings - Outputting JSON arrays as a series of objects - Using threading for HTTP requests - Using Pd-extended library template 0.1: - Basic operations for connection to CouchDB - Basic JSON encoding and decoding
